FRANCIS R. GOING, OF BOSTON, MASSACHUSETTS.
IMPROVEMENT IN HAT-BLOCKS.
Specification forming part of Lett ers Patent No. 159,088, dated January 26, 1875; application liled December 2, 1874.
To all whom it may concern:
Be it known that I, FRANCIS R. GOING, of Boston, in the county of Suffolk and State of Massachusetts, have invented an Improvement in Hat-Blocks, of which the following is a specification Y My invention relates to a holder or form for sustaining hats in pouncingmachines, and consists in a hollow block constructed as hereinafter described.
In pouneing hats they are stretched over or on a block made of a solid piece of wood. These blocks are carried at the top of a vertical shaft, which is rotated several times in one, and then in the opposite, direction, a reciprocating rack engaging a toothed gear on the vertical shaft. This shaft is turned very rapidly, and its motion is reversed very quickly, and consequently the machine has to be very strong, and especially so as the momentum of the shaft, owing to the heavy wooden block, is very great, and the strain on the machine and shaft is also very great when the motion of the shaft is suddenly reversed. I obviate all this strain on the shaft, save power, and make a lighter and easier running machine than has been heretofore made.
Figure l is a side view of my invention, and Fig. 2 is a cross-section.
My block A, for the pouncing-machine, is made of a thick strong piece of felt, fashioned to conform to the shape of the hat to be pounced, whether round or oblong, and stili'- ened or hardened by glue or other suitable hardening compound, and the outer side is preferably varnished to make it smooth. The block A is made hollow, or as a shell, and has fitted to it a bottom or end piece, B, bored to receive a flanged collar, O, suitably attached by means of screws, and provided witha groove or spline itted to receive or lit a spline or groove on the top of the usual vertical shaft of the pouncing-maehine.
rThis hollow block, instead of being of felt, might be of leather-board properly hardened, of stift' paper, of woven material, ot' thin metal, or might be made as a thin shell of wood, the wood being in the shape of veneers or solid, the block being sustained at bottom against inward pressure by a bottom piece.
I claim- A hollow hat-block formed of a felt or paper shell and a suitable supportingbase, suhstantially as described.
